Iota Biosciences develops advanced medical devices focused on neuromodulation and bioelectronic medicine. Based in the United States, the company specializes in creating implantable devices that interface with the nervous system to treat various medical conditions. Engineering efforts at Iota Biosciences involve firmware development for embedded systems, with a focus on real-time data processing and wireless communication. The team works on integrating sophisticated algorithms for signal processing and device control, contributing to the advancement of medical technology in the neuromodulation field.
